Yep, it's a residential house. They likely just have regular internet service. I assume they have the website/hosting service in a datacenter somewhere which could cost quite a bit, but it's only a single 720p feed. 720 uses about about 3Mbp/s, which is about 2TB/day per feed. That's nothing for guaranteed bandwidth. They may be recording locally, but if not it's about $10/TB of storage. It probably isn't costing them much.
